I know I know, This has been discussed to death before.

I did research and SD.net comes back with 6 pages of matches. And after reading a lot, I took out and tested the Reg/Rec as per



This video and it checks out ok.

the values were
.505 .505 .507
0 0 0
0 0 0
.512 .502 .508

So I just ordered a Shorai Battery that should be here on Thursday. The voltage of the 1 year old battery while OFF the bike was 12.5V. Today, It would not crank the engine over. It happened to me 3 weeks ago, after filling up, prior to going on vacation. And I left the bike connected to my Battery Tender for 2 weeks and upon return I cannot ride it. Arrgh! Frustrating.
